Winter Olympics 2022: Day 9 schedule, what to watch, results and more from Beijing

After a gold medal-less start through the first six days of the 2022 Beijing Olympics, Team USA got on the board thanks to wins from snowboarder Chloe Kim and figure skater Nathan Chen. Day 9 of the Games features four medal events, giving the Americans a significant opportunity to climb the leaderboard. 

Three-time gold medalist Shaun White, who’s retiring from competitive snowboarding after these Games, competed in his last ever men’s halfpipe final on Thursday. The 35-year-old placed fourth with a best score of 85.00. Japan’s Ayumu Hirano, Australia’s Scotty James and Switzerland’s Jan Scherrer won gold, silver and bronze, respectively. Also, Mikaela Shiffrin competed in the women’s super-G. While she completed an event for the first time at the 2022 Winter Games, Shiffrin finished in ninth place. 

Now, for Day 9 of the Olympics, here’s what to expect. 

Team USA schedule — Friday, Feb. 11

  • Women’s curling round robin, USA vs. China – 1 a.m.
  • Men’s cross country skiing 15km final – 2 a.m.
  • Men’s speed skating 10,000m final – 3 a.m. 
  • Women’s speed skating 1,000m final – 7:30 a.m.
  • Men’s skeleton final – 8:55 a.m.
  • Snowboarding cross mixed team final – 9 p.m.
  • Women’s hockey quarterfinal, USA vs. Czech Republic – 11p.m.
